2019年末爆发的新型冠状病毒事件,使人们对突发公共卫生事件的预 警制度产生了热议.要从风险规制的角度看待这一制度,有必要重温风险 规制的流程以及该流程中对民主和科学的安排,并回顾我国突发公共卫 生事件预警的制度内容.在此基础上,结合武汉疫情的早期预防的事实, 发现预警制度在风险识别阶段中其风险信息交流存在政府与公众缺乏互 动、交流形式多样化不足;在风险评估阶段专家及专业机构的独立性和 科学性缺乏保障;预警的发布阶段缺乏效果评价的机制等问题。着眼于 未来,在风险识别阶段最好能够设计行政机关与公众的风险交流的互动 机制,引入多样化的信息交流途径,扩大信息收集的范围,克服疫情信 息报告中的不报、瞒报、迟报等问题.在风险评估阶段要保障专家和专业 机构的相对独立性,赋予其早期警示的权力和评估信息公开的义务.最 后,建设预警发布的评价机制,使预警的正确经验能够较好的积累,预 警的偏差能够及时的纠正.
The outbreak of novel coronavirus in 2019 has caused a heated debate on the public health emergency warning system. To view this system from the perspective of risk regulation, it is necessary to review the process of it and the democratic and scientific arrangements in the process, and review the content of early warning system of public health emergencies in China. On this basis, combined with the fact of early prevention of the epidemic in Wuhan, it is found that in the risk identification stage, the risk information exchange of the early warning system is lack of interaction between the government and the public, and the communication forms are not diversified; in the risk assessment stage, the independence and scientificity of experts and professional institutions are not be guaranteed; and the effect evaluation mechanism is lack in the release stage of early warning. With a view to the future, in the risk identification stage, it is better to design an interactive mechanism of risk communication between the administrative authorities and the public, introduce diversified information exchange channels, expand the scope of information collection, and overcome the problems of non reporting, concealment and delayed reporting in the reporting of epidemic information. In the stage of risk assessment, it is necessary to guarantee the relative independence of experts and professional institutions, endow them with the power of early warning and the obligation of disclosure of assessment information. Finally, build the evaluation mechanism of early warning release, so that the correct experience of early warning can be better accumulated, and the deviation of early warning can be corrected in time.
